Michael Jackson, often referred to as the “King of Pop,” was a groundbreaking artist who revolutionized the music scene in the 1980s. With his incredible vocal range, dance moves, and unique songwriting abilities, Jackson captivated audiences worldwide. His albums like “Thriller,” “Bad,” and “Dangerous” have sold millions of copies, making him the best-selling music artist of all time. Jackson’s influence on music, fashion, and pop culture cannot be overstated, as he broke barriers and set new standards for artists to come.
On the other hand, Taylor Swift is a contemporary artist who has gained immense popularity in the 21st century. Known for her storytelling and relatable lyrics, Swift has become a role model for many young fans. Her albums, such as “Fearless,” “1989,” and “Reputation,” have topped charts and won numerous awards. Swift’s ability to connect with her audience through her personal experiences has earned her a dedicated fan base and the title of “Queen of Pop” in some circles.
When comparing the two artists, it’s essential to consider their contributions to music. Michael Jackson’s influence on pop music is undeniable. He was the first African American to become a worldwide cultural icon and paved the way for artists of color in the industry. His innovative music videos, such as “Thriller” and “Billie Jean,” set new standards for visual storytelling. Jackson’s dance moves, like the moonwalk, became iconic and have been emulated by countless artists over the years.
Conversely, Taylor Swift has brought a fresh perspective to the music industry with her storytelling and relatable lyrics. Her ability to write songs that resonate with her audience has made her a fan favorite. Swift’s evolution from country to pop has allowed her to explore various genres and appeal to a broader audience. Her collaborations with other artists, such as Ed Sheeran and The Weeknd, have further solidified her status as a versatile and talented musician.
